Super Shuttle will definitely take you from a residence to PortMiami. Paid $80 for private van from central Broward County to the port; was worth every penny and from Doral will cost less. To book online you can select PortMiami as your destination, for "flight time" (sic) just put a couple hours before sailing time; they will then assume you want to be at the port 60-90 min before then.
